INFOKU, BLORA – The Director of RSUD Dr R. Soetijono Blora took swift action to impose sanctions on two civil servants in his agency, reprimanding the cashier and admin for negligence in administrative services.
Starting from the patient reporting that there was no administrative transparency for patients who paid in cash. Thus, it is suspected of committing illegal levies (pungli).
“Both of them made negligence in terms of administration. However, in imposing sanctions, the hospital still refers to existing regulations or stages," said Director of RSUD Dr R Soetijono Blora Puji Basuki.
Puji said that the sanctions imposed on the two civil servants with the initials K and I were only in the form of a written warning, because there were steps involved first.
"Both of them are in charge of the cashier and administration of data input at the local hospital," he explained.
After giving sanctions, ensure that they will evaluate and minimize the occurrence of errors that harm the patient.

Ask for community participation to participate in supervising services in their agencies.
"We need input from the community, of course so that in the future Dr R Soetijono Blora Hospital will provide more excellent service," he explained.
Previously, it was known that one of the families of Blora Hospital patients named Agus had revealed administrative irregularities.

The Rp. 6 million requested by the hospital staff to be paid in cash, cannot be transferred via an ATM. Even though it was already late at night.
After the administration fee had been paid in cash, Agus asked for a memorandum detailing the costs, but this was not allowed.

At that time, the patient's family was lucky because they were allowed to document it via photos.
According to him, the irregularities continued when in the documented detail note, it was written BPJS NON PBI.

Head of Commission D DPRD Blora Ahmad Labib Hilmy said the sanctions were given to give a deterrent effect to work even better.
A quick handling system for a problem can be a reference for the regional apparatus organization (OPD) in Blora.
"In addition to rewards, of course punishment must be given if the performance is not appropriate. In my opinion, other OPDs need to implement this, of course it will have an impact on service progress," he said. ( Endah / IST )
